name | Lithium niobate | |
chemical components | LiNbO3 | |
Melting point (mp) | 1253 | |
lattice | Triangle system | |
Crystal density (ps) | 4.464 × 103kg / m 3 | |
Curie temperature (Tc) | 1145 ℃ | |
Thermal capacity (Cp) | 89J / K.mol | |
Thermal expansion coefficient | 15.4 × 10-6 / ℃ 7.5 | |
hardness | 5.0 | |
Dielectric constant | (X11T) | 85.2 |
(X33T) | 28.7 | |
Elastic strength | (C11E) | 2.03 × 1011N / m 2 |
(C12E) | 0.573 | |
(C13E) | 0.752 | |
(C14E) | 0.085 | |
(C33E) | 2.424 | |
(C44E) | 0.595 | |
(C66E) | 0.728 | |
Piezoelectric strain constant | (D15) | 6.92 × 10-11C'N |
(D22) | 2.08 | |
(D31) | -0.085 | |
(D33) | 0.60 |
Cutting direction | Direction of transmission | Surface wave velocity (m / s) | Coupling coefficient (%) | Temperature delay coefficient (ppm / ℃) | Propagation loss (db / cm) |
127.86 ° Y-Cut | X-Axis | 3980 | 5.5 | 75 | - |
64 ° Y-Cut | X-Axis | 4742 | 11.2 | 70 | - |
41 ° Y-Cut | X-Axis | 4792 | 17.3 | 50 | - |
Y-Cut | X-Axis | 3488 | 4.9 | 94 | 0.31 (GHz) |
Filters, resonators, delay lines, signal compression, and stretching.
It is a transparent ferroelectric single crystal with piezoelectric, photoelectric and acousto-optic characteristics, low acoustic wave transmission loss and low surface acoustic wave propagation speed.
